Ember Charter School

Serving 521 students in grades Kindergarten-11, 
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 20-24% (which is lower than the New York state average of 48%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 35-39% (which is lower than the New York state average of 40%).
The student:teacher ratio of 13:1 is higher than the New York state level of 11:1.

School Overview

Ember Charter School's student population of 521 students has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
The teacher population of 39 teachers has declined by 18% over five school years.
